NASHVILLE, Tennessee, Jan. 24 [TNSgrants]-- Vanderbilt University issued the following news:
A Vanderbilt Divinity School collaboration committed to harnessing the power of public theology to combat racism will thrive and expand its reach, thanks to renewed support from the Henry Luce Foundation.
The Luce Foundation has awarded a $500,000 grant to the Divinity School's Public Theology and Racial Justice Collaborative for its second phase--to establish mobile institutes . . .
